The Future of Patient Transfer Technologies in Healthcare Facilities
The fundamental architecture of the global Patient Lift Systems Market is profoundly shaped by strict global occupational safety standards. Regulatory agencies globally have identified manual patient handling as the primary contributor to severe musculoskeletal disorders among clinical nursing workforces. Consequently, legislative updates mandating the deployment of mechanical assist devices have turned standard corporate safety guidelines into legally enforceable compliance baselines.
Compliance-driven demand has pushed facility managers to re-engineer standard architectural spaces to accommodate integrated ceiling-mounted track systems. Beyond mitigating staff injury insurance claims, these structural shifts drastically reduce the direct overhead costs linked to staff absenteeism and nursing turnover rates. Consequently, prioritizing caregiver physical wellbeing has evolved from an ethical obligation to a core strategy for modern hospital operational risk management.

How do caregiver safety regulations affect market expansion?
Strict laws penalizing manual lifting practices compel healthcare executives to allocate steady capital budgets for advanced mechanical lifting infrastructure.
What specific operational injuries are minimized by patient lifters?
Mechanical lifters significantly reduce chronic lower back strain, shoulder injuries, and disk herniations caused by repetitive manual pulling and repositioning.
Does installing mechanical lifts lower overall hospital operational expenses?
Yes, by significantly reducing worker compensation claims, minimizing injury-related employee absenteeism, and decreasing the need for temporary replacement staff.
